Final Fantasy XIV Shows Off Some Knights Of The Round EX Weapons

Recommended Videos

Final Fantasy XIV is getting its first major update after its Heavesward expansion, and it’ll bring a new 24-man raid, Lord of Verminion RTS mini-game, and more. The Developer’s Blog shared a look at some weapons that we’ll get from Patch 3.1’s Knights of the Round (Extreme) fight.

Final Fantasy XIV’s Patch 3.1 update, called “As Goes Light, So Goes Darkness” will launch on November 10, 2015. You can check out our earlier report for more details on what else the update will include.
